Handover Note — Spare Hardware Storage

Hi Priya,

Before I move to the Larkspur team, a quick note for the new starters: spare monitors, docks, and cables live in Room B14 behind the print hub at Oakhaven Place. Log anything you take on the clipboard inside the door. The room stays locked; new starters can open it with the code below.

door code, yagap-bahof: bdg-O-05

Ticket: SpokeShift vault locked itself again. The rebalancing tool can't read dock capacities, so the overnight van routes didn't generate. Trucks roll at 05:30, so this is time-sensitive. Restarting the service won't help — the credentials vault needs a manual unseal first. You can unseal it from the ops box using the recovery passphrase below.

vault phrase of bagaf-kajeg = jorath-feniel-briir-siliel-ralix

## Deployment

Mailgrove's bounce processor deploys via the standard pipeline: tag a release, promote through staging, then prod. Canary runs at 5% for one hour before full rollout. Rollback is a single pipeline action. Verify queue depth is flat post-deploy before closing the release. The configuration applied at deploy time is listed below.

deployment values, kajep-kageg:
[praix]
host = praix.paliqcorp.corp
user = praix_svc
database = praix_prod